Liberty Interactive Corporation (LINTA) Downgraded by Zacks to UNDERPERFORM

Zacks Zacks Investment Research downgraded shares of Liberty Interactive Corporation (LINTA) from NEUTRAL to UNDERPERFORM on March 21, 2013, with a target price of $19.00.

We are downgrading our recommendation on Liberty Interactive to Underperform based on the company's weak financial results for the fourth quarter of 2012. While top line barely met the Zacks Consensus Estimate, net income fell below the same. Meanwhile, the stock price has also soared nearly 34% in the last year and is trading at the high end of its 52-week price range. The slowing growth of the most important QVC segment is a major near-term concern for the company. Continuation of global macroeconomic headwinds and volatility in the foreign exchange rates may result in fluctuating top line for the company's TV home shopping business. Furthermore, the company's e-commerce businesses are suffering losses. This may affect the brand value of Liberty Interactive. We believe that the company is currently overvalued as we do not find any near-term catalyst for Liberty Interactive.
